Dragon Age: Theories on The Qunari (& kossith)
Welcome back to Talking Dragon Age, the show where I talk about Dragon Age. Today, we're talking about a bunch of theories relating to the Qunari. Specifically, we discuss their origins and their current plans, and how someone or some people may be manipulating them.

    Looking at the argument for determining how powerful demons are, I’m zeroing in on the idea that more demons of more complex emotions have more territory in the Fade. I think that’s what actually determines power level. We see weak and strong spirits of all types in each game. So a Rage Demon that’s born of someone’s childhood grudge would be far weaker than a Rage Demon that encompasses say… tortured Mages of a Circle? So Pride demons are typically more powerful because there’s a lot of complexity that creates Pride. Looking at Solas’s friend, the Spirit of Wisdom, it became a pretty powerful Pride demon likely because of the knowledge it represented and the territory it held in the Fade. So we see a bunch of fear demons of varying strength throughout Inquisition but then we see the big one, Nightmare. I think that an entity that represents the fears and horrors related to the Blight would of course be something immensely powerful and that would hold a lot of territory. While the concept of the Blight is simple, the fears of an entire continent over generations of pain would certainly birth something complex and powerful. IDK That’s my interpretation of the complex = power comment
